Breaking-News >> TodayHistory On March 23, 1927, Chiang Kai-shek made the "Anqing Massacre"
On this day, 98 years ago, March 23, 1927 (February 20, 1927, the lunar calendar), Chiang Kai-shek committed the "Anqing Massacre". After Chiang Kai-shek settled in Nanchang, he created a series of counter-revolutionary incidents in order to gain the support of imperialism and the comprador class. In March 1927, Chiang Kai-shek fled to Anqing, organized the so-called "Anhui Federation of Trade Unions", and bribed death squads everywhere. On March 23, Chiang Kai-shek ordered the local ruffians and hooligans he had bought to destroy the Kuomintang Party Headquarters in Anhui Province led by the Kuomintang leftists, the Kuomintang Party Headquarters in Anqing City, and the Federation of Trade Unions led by the Communist Party. Revolutionary groups such as the Provincial Farmers 'Association and the Municipal Women's Association robbed them of documents and belongings, injured dozens of employees and representatives of the Provincial Congress, and seriously injured many people, creating the Anqing tragedy.
